Neptune Energy, Sval Energi and Storegga awarded CO2 storage licence in the Norwegian North Sea
The Trudvang area has the potential to store up to 9 million t of CO2 annually for at least 25 years – a total of 225 million t – with analysis indicating the storage potential could be even higher.

Carbon Catalyst receives two licence awards for its Orion carbon capture and storage project
Perenco UK and Carbon Catalyst Limited have announced the award of two carbon storage licences by the North Sea Transition Authority (NSTA) to progress the Orion carbon storage project in the Southern North Sea sector of the UK Continental Shelf.
